The Hiram & Solomon Master Mason Toro Cigar combines a blend of Habano-seed filler leaves from Jalapa, Ometepe, and Esteli. These are bound by an Indonesian Sumatra binder and finished with a dark Habano Ecuadorian wrapper in oscuro shade. The tobaccos yield flavors of baker’s cocoa, leather, sweet cedar, toasted nuts, and aromatic spices.
